En Agosto de 2006 la revista alemana PS realizó un comparativo de amortiguadores para la R1200GS.
Para resumir valoró tres aspectos de 1 a 5 y el resultado fué el siguiente.
Ordenado por Gama de ajustes/Facilidad de reglajes/Comportamiento.
BMW Serie 2/4/2
Hyperpro 367/469 (3D) 4/4/3
Öhlins 437/436 3/4/3
Wilbers 630/640 (R12) 3/4/4
Wilbers 642 (R12) 4/4/5
WP Suspension EDS 3/5/3 Sistema similar al ESA
WP Suspension 4014 Emulsion 3/4/4
WP Suspension 4014 Spin 4/4/5
